3 Manufacturing Breakthroughs You Can't Ignore

1. Selective Soldering:Reduces thermal stress on sensitive components by 30-45% compared to wave soldering. 2. Ceramic Substrates:Withstand temperatures up to 300°C – perfect for electric vehicle charging stations. 3. AI-Driven Quality Control:Cuts defect rates from 500ppm to below 50ppm.
